Glaucoma

Glaucoma usually develops slowly, and many people do not notice any changes at first. Regular checks help pick up signs before they start affecting your vision.

Cornea

The cornea is the window to the eye, and its clarity and shape play a key role in your vision. When affected, it can lead to changes in vision that require careful evaluation.

Diabetic Eye Care

Diabetes can affect your eyes over time, and you might not notice it straight away. That is why regular eye checks matter.
